Improve widget formatting and add logged-in users support
Services widget: - Fix disk quota formatting with proper rounding instead of truncation - Remove decimals from RAM quotas and use GB instead of G - Change quota display to use GB consistently Backups widget: - Change GiB to GB for consistency - Remove spaces between numbers and units - Update disk usage format to match other widgets: used (totalGB) - Remove percentage display for cleaner format System widget: - Add support for logged-in users in description lines - Format C-states with "C-State:" prefix on first line, indent subsequent lines - Add logged_in_users field to SystemSummary data structure Documentation: - Add example hash error output to NixOS update instructions
